Transaction e20631c3269d199a60cd852d090c59e6e034aaaa0c4f7c1f1e0f6e7b3edff934

1 Input
2 Outputs
  • e20631c3269d199a60cd852d090c59e6e034aaaa0c4f7c1f1e0f6e7b3edff934:0
  • value  40802496
    address  3DV4utkDLWJgERekWoun8xRGCM18Uw1BmK
  • e20631c3269d199a60cd852d090c59e6e034aaaa0c4f7c1f1e0f6e7b3edff934:1
  • value  38901334
    address  1FQjWvXorC3ErQhakuuyPGLSMxpB4z66tV